Subject: [PATCH] ARM: dts: at91: sama5d2 Xplained: Correct the macb irq pinctrl node

Le 18/02/2016 11:21, Romain Izard a ?crit :
> All pinctrl nodes for the Atmel pinctrl controller need to have their
> bias configuration explicitly defined. Otherwise, the pinctrl mapping
> is not valid.
>
> It works for now as the pinctrl driver proceeds even with invalid
> mappings, but this can become an issue, if the pinctrl driver starts
> to require valid mappings. Additionally, the pin is not protected from
> being remapped later by an other driver.
>
> There is an external 1k? pull-up to 3.3V, so no bias is required on
> the Ethernet PHY's interrupt line.

> arch/arm/boot/dts/at91-sama5d2_xplained.dts | 1 +
> 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+)
>
> diff --git a/arch/arm/boot/dts/at91-sama5d2_xplained.dts b/arch/arm/boot/dts/at91-sama5d2_xplained.dts
> index e683856c507c..75341eec2dfd 100644
> --- a/arch/arm/boot/dts/at91-sama5d2_xplained.dts
> +++ b/arch/arm/boot/dts/at91-sama5d2_xplained.dts
> @@ -308,6 +308,7 @@
>
> pinctrl_macb0_phy_irq: macb0_phy_irq {
> pinmux = <PIN_PC9__GPIO>;
> + bias-disable;
> };
>
> pinctrl_pdmic_default: pdmic_default {
>
